Transform Reservation Data into Actionable Business Insights

For hospitality organizations, reservation data is one of the most valuable business assets. Reservation Management Systems (RMS) capture critical information about bookings, guest profiles, activities, arrivals, departures, occupancy, and operational performance. However, when this data remains isolated within operational systems, organizations often struggle to gain meaningful insights.
Microsoft Fabric provides a modern analytics platform that helps hospitality businesses centralize, transform, and analyze RMS data, enabling faster and more informed decision-making.
Why RMS Data Integration Matters
Hospitality leaders need accurate and timely information to optimize operations, improve guest experiences, and maximize revenue. Manual reporting processes and disconnected data sources often result in:
Limited visibility into occupancy and booking trends
Time-consuming report preparation
Data inconsistencies across departments
Delayed decision-making
Challenges in forecasting and planning
By integrating RMS data into Microsoft Fabric, organizations can create a single source of truth for reporting and analytics.
Our RMS Integration Approach
Recently, Aptocoiner Analytics successfully implemented an end-to-end RMS analytics solution using Microsoft Fabric.
Business Requirement Analysis
We worked with stakeholders to identify key reporting requirements and relevant RMS APIs for:
Reservations
Guest information
Activities
Occupancy
Operational reporting
API Integration and Data Ingestion
Our team researched RMS API documentation to understand:
Available endpoints
Authentication methods
Request parameters
Pagination requirements
Response structures
Using secure authentication tokens and PySpark notebooks, we developed automated data extraction processes and implemented pagination logic to retrieve complete datasets from RMS APIs.

Microsoft Fabric Lakehouse Implementation
Extracted data was loaded into Microsoft Fabric Lakehouse, where we performed:
Data cleansing
Schema standardization
Data transformation
Data quality validation
This created a reliable and scalable analytics foundation.
Business Intelligence and Reporting
To support executive and operational reporting, we developed:
Date dimensions
MTD (Month-to-Date) calculations
YTD (Year-to-Date) calculations
Variance analysis
Occupancy and booking KPIs
Interactive Power BI dashboards were created to provide visibility into:
Reservations
Guest activities
Occupancy metrics
Booking status
Operational performance
